Role Overview:

We are seeking an experienced Voids and Disrepair Site Manager to oversee the management of void properties and address disrepair issues across our portfolio in Dalston. This role is pivotal in ensuring properties are efficiently maintained and returned to a habitable state promptly, while also managing tenant relationships and coordinating with contractors.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Manage the entire void process from inspection to refurbishment, ensuring timely turnaround of properties.
  • Oversee disrepair claims, conducting thorough inspections and liaising with tenants to address issues effectively.
  • Coordinate and supervise contractors and maintenance teams to ensure work is completed to a high standard and within budget.
  • Develop and maintain strong relationships with tenants, providing excellent customer service and support.
  • Maintain accurate records of inspections, repairs, and progress reports.
  • Monitor compliance with health and safety regulations and ensure all work meets legal and quality standards.
  • Prepare regular reports for senior management on void turnaround times, disrepair cases, and overall performance metrics.
  • Identify areas for improvement in processes and implement best practices to enhance efficiency.

Qualifications:

  • Proven experience in property management, specifically with voids and disrepair processes.
  • Strong understanding of housing regulations and compliance requirements.
  • Excellent organizational and time management skills.
  • Effective communication and interpersonal skills, with a focus on customer service.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Proficiency in property management software and Microsoft Office Suite.
